At Yellow Belly Dragway, the roaring engines of beasts like the Kraken, Bank Robber, and Snot Rocket echo through the air. The team is amidst the thrilling Home Run Derby, showcasing small tire cars with big ambitions. Each racer, from the seasoned veterans to the young guns, is here to conquer the track and claim victory. The Kraken, with its stock block and twin 72s, stands ready to unleash its power, while the Bank Robber's small block LS and procharger hint at the speed it possesses. Meanwhile, the Snot Rocket's 565 big block and F3 136 procharger promise a wild ride down the strip.
